I was there a month and half ago. Was my first time in a Muslim country, it was very cool because you get to see all the muslim stuff in person but you can still buy alcohol easily. There are a lot of stray cats and dogs on the street, but very well behaved and friendly. Things are generally very cheap, most places accept USD due to severe inflation, so you don't really need to exchange a lot of turkish currency.

Food is mostly great with 2 exceptions. I've been eating through North America, East Asia and Western Europe and my palette is fairly middle of the road. Yet I find Turkish meat dishes tend to be very salty, to a point where I have to hold off eating the salad/soup first just so I can have them with meat dishes together. This applies to Michelin restaurant I visited in Istanbul, street vendor food, as well as hotel restaurant that serves mostly tourists. The second exception is desserts are mostly very sweet. They'd take what I'd consider to be a completed dessert and soak it in honey or other type of sweetened liquid. What I really liked for breakfast though is real honeycomb which is easy to find instead of just honey.
